What Causes Conservatory Roof Damage?
Table 1: Common Causes of Conservatory Roof Damage
TriggerDescriptionSevere WeatherHeavy rain, hail, snow, and strong winds can damage roofing products.Aging MaterialsGradually, products can weaken, leading to leaks and structural issues.Poor InstallationInadequate setup can lead to vulnerabilities that worsen damage.Lack of MaintenanceIgnoring routine examinations and maintenance can result in unnoticed issues.Tree DebrisFalling branches and leaves can pierce or obstruct roof drain systems.Poor drainObstructed seamless gutters or inadequate water management can cause pooling and leaks.
Comprehending these prospective causes is the very first action in recognizing and attending to any damage to a conservatory roof.
Indications of a Damaged Conservatory Roof
Determining the indications of a damaged conservatory roof early can help prevent more severe issues down the line. Property owners ought to be vigilant in acknowledging the following signs:

Table 2: Signs of a Damaged Conservatory Roof
SignDescriptionWater StainsDiscoloration on the ceiling or walls shows prospective leaks.Mould or MildewThe existence of mould or mildew suggests wetness accumulation.DraftsCold air leakage might signify gaps or damaged seals in the roofing.broken conservatory glass or Missing PanelsVisible cracks or missing out on areas suggest structural compromise.Unusual NoisesSounds such as rattling or banging might suggest loose roof elements.Condensation Build-upExcess condensation may indicate insulation issues or ventilation issues.
Homeowners ought to have a routine inspection schedule to catch these indications early. A proactive approach makes sure that repairs can be made before the damage escalates.
Repairing a Damaged Conservatory Roof
When attending to a damaged conservatory roof, house owners have a variety of alternatives based upon the degree of the damage and the materials involved.
Kinds of Repairs
Sealing Leaks
Small leaks can typically be sealed with suitable roofing sealants. This is an affordable fast fix conservatory leaks that can assist avoid further water damage.
Panel Replacement
If individual glass or polycarbonate panels are split or missing out on, they can be changed. House owners must guarantee that the new panels match the existing ones in density and material structure.
Strengthening Structure
If the roof structure itself is jeopardized, it might require support. This could include adding extra assistances or changing beams that have actually decomposed or compromised.
Full Roof Replacement

As soon as repairs have been made or a brand-new roof installed, appropriate maintenance is vital to extend its life and performance. Here are some maintenance tips to think about:

Regular Inspections
Arrange routine checks a minimum of two times a year, ideally in spring and fall, to look for indications of wear or damage.
Clean Gutters and Drains
Keep rain gutters clear of debris to ensure correct drainage and prevent water pooling on the roof.
Inspect Seals and Joints
Check the seals and joints for indications of wear and change them as necessary to prevent leaks.
Trim Nearby Trees
Regularly trim trees near the conservatory to reduce the threat of debris falling on the roof.
Screen Indoor Conditions

Q: How long should a conservatory roof last?A: The life-span of
a conservatory roof varies by product-- glass panels can last 20-30 years, while polycarbonate may need replacement every 10-15 years.

Q: Can I repair a conservatory roof myself?A: Minor repairs can
be dealt with by house owners, but it is advised to seek advice from a professional for significant damage to ensure security and efficiency. Q: What are the signs that a conservatory roof
needs replacing?A: Persistent leaks, comprehensive splitting, and structural instability are clear indicators that a roof might need replacement. Q: How much does it cost to repair a conservatory roof?A: Repair expenses vary widely based upon the degree of the damage, the materials utilized, and labor; an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 100 to ₤ 2000 or more.
